> In the Linux perf tool, the ring buffer serves not only as a medium for
> transferring PMU event data but also as a vital mechanism for hardware
> tracing using technologies like Intel PT and Arm CoreSight, etc.
>
> Consequently, the ring buffer mechanism plays a crucial role by ensuring
> high throughput for data transfer between the kernel and user space
> while avoiding excessive overhead caused by the ring buffer itself.
>
> This commit documents the ring buffer mechanism in detail. It provides
> an in-depth explanation of the implementation of both the generic ring
> buffer and the AUX ring buffer. Additionally, it covers how these ring
> buffers support various tracing modes and explains the synchronization
> with memory barriers.
